Abstract
The invention discloses a multi-light source color sorter, which comprises a main light source, filters, material flows, a main sensing device, an auxiliary light source, an auxiliary sensing device, a background plate and a control chip. The main light source emits light into the filters for irradiating on the material flows and then reflecting to a light-transmissive CCD lense, the CCD lense is provided in the main sensing device and the CCD lense transmits a light signal to the control chip, a visible light emitted by the auxiliary light source is reflected to the material flow though a reflector and a background plate, and delivered to the control chip after transmitted to the auxiliary sensing device, a laser emitter and a monitor are provided at the relative position of the main light source, the laser emitter is only taken as a sorted object for polluting, and a signal of the sorted object is collected by the monitor to convey to a sorting system for sorting. According to the invention, the multi-light source color sorter solves the problem that the different materials with same color can not be preferably distinguished for sorting. The invention has the advantages of simple design and reasonable structure. A combination light source of a fluorescent lamp and the laser emitter is used for a secondary sorting, thereby a good sorting effect is obtained for increasing the usage scope of the functions of the color sorter provided in the invention.

Background technology
With making rapid progress of painted choosing letter sorting technology, begin to develop into more applications fields such as grain, vegetables, fruit, ore from rice, previous traditional look selects the letter sorting technology can not satisfy our present huge market demand.At first market wishes that our look selects letter sorting can contain more field; Secondly can sort more multi-classly, a material multiselect, comprise color, colour mixture, material or the like.At present traditional color selector is by the application of colored CCD, and it is bigger to have developed into the leeway that can select, but still can't well distinguish letter sorting on the different material of same color.
